Guest Wi-Fi desk — visiting contractors. On arrival at Harlowe Point, check in at the guest Wi-Fi desk to the left of the main reception counter. Staff there will register your device and issue a day voucher for the contractor network. Vouchers expire at midnight and must be renewed each visit. To reach the desk area itself, enter through the glass partition using the code below.

door code, yagap-bahof: bdg-O-05

Subject: Handover — consent banner rollout

Hi Tobin,

The Fennelgate consent banner is live on all tenant sites. Plugin authors should read consent state from the shared preferences table rather than setting cookies themselves. Schema docs are in the plugin portal. For testing against the staging consent database, use the connection string below.

warehouse DSN: mssql://rusdor_svc:0FSWCn9@db-951a.paliqforge.local:5432/ulawyn

Management Meeting Minutes — Hiring Freeze, Coastal Division

Attendees: Priya Vossen, Tam Elderic, June Okari.

Decision confirmed: all Coastal Division requisitions paused through quarter-end, including backfills. Sales leads should redirect pipeline support requests to the Harrow team. Exceptions require Priya's written approval. Contractors already engaged may complete current statements of work. The reasoning follows.

management briefing: The renewal with Zoraelax Group closes at $10 million a year, 15 percent below the last contract. Project Ralael slips by six weeks because of the audit delay.